一;设置 input 标签 <input type="file" ref="fileInput" @change="handleFileChange"/>1.将 input 标签的 type 属性设置为 file 。使用 type="file" 的 <input> 元素使得用户可以选择一个或多个元素以提交表单的方式上传到服务
父子组件之间数据传递父向子:属性绑定v-bind(简写 : ) + props父组件中使用子组件时,绑定属性传递数据给子组件, 子组件使用 props 进行数据的接收eg: 父组件 传递数据:<child :num="6"></child>子组件 接收和使用数据:<template> <div> <!-- 使用数据 -->
**教你如何在Vue中使用Axios发送数据** --- 作为一名经验丰富的开发者,我将会指导你如何在Vue项目中使用Axios发送数据。首先,我们需要了解整个流程,然后逐步进行实现。 ### 流程图 ```mermaid flowchart TD Start -->|Step 1| Initialize Axios Initialize_Axios -->|Step 2|
原创 5月前
22阅读
前言: Vue的使用使前端程序员主要精力放在业务上,省去了大量dom的操作。身边的很多同事仍然使用JQuery的ajax发送请求,使用JQuery 也就仅仅使用了封装好的ajax,这样给页面的加载增加负担,JQuery的引入使页面的加载显的很笨重。前端发送请求的方式很多种,不一定要再页面上大量使用JQuery封装的ajax,有几种请求方式可以省去JQuery的引入进行ajax请
# Vue中使用Axios发送POST请求 ## 流程图 ```mermaid flowchart TD; A(开始) --> B(引入Axios); B --> C(创建请求示例); C --> D(设置请求配置); D --> E(发送请求); E --> F(处理响应数据); F --> G(结束); ``` ## 步骤说明 以下是使用
原创 9月前
43阅读
在main页面全局开启发送cookie//main.js axios.defaults.withCredentials=true //开启发送cookie
原创 2023-05-26 00:09:31
82阅读
# Vue 发送 Axios 请求 Axios 是一个基于 Promise 的 HTTP 客户端,可以在浏览器和 Node.js 中发送 HTTP 请求。Vue 是一个流行的 JavaScript 框架,可以帮助开发者构建用户界面。在 Vue 中,我们可以轻松地发送 Ajax 请求并处理响应。本文将介绍如何在 Vue 中使用 Axios 发送请求,并提供一些示例代码。 ## 什么是 Axios
原创 2023-09-06 16:05:33
235阅读
# 如何在Vue中使用Axios发送文件 ## 简介 在Vue项目中,我们经常需要使用Axios发送请求。有时候我们需要发送文件,比如图片或者文档,那么该如何实现呢?在本文中,我将向你展示如何使用VueAxios发送文件。 ### 整体流程 首先,让我们来看一下整件事情的流程。下面是一个简单的表格展示了发送文件的步骤: | 步骤 | 操作 | | --- | --- | | 1 | 安装
原创 5月前
32阅读
9. axios发送请求 9.0. axios的引入: 9.1. axios的基本使用:  9.1.1. axios发送get请求  9.1.2. axios发送post请求: 9.2. axios使用别名发送请求:  9.2.1. axios.get()发送get请求  9.2.2. axios.post()发送post请求 9.3. axios使用小总结: 9.4. axios的全局配置: 9
发送AJAX请求 1. 简介 vue本身不支持发送AJAX请求,需要使用vue-resource、axios等插件实现 axios是一个基于Promise的HTTP请求客户端,用来发送请求,也是vue2.0官方推荐的,同时不再对vue-resource进行更新和维护  参考:GitHub上搜索axios,查看API文档 2. 使用axios发送AJAX请求 
转载 2023-06-14 08:45:42
109阅读
之前的项目中使用过一次vuex搭配localstorage存储token,使token持久化保存。好长时间不用,又把vuex的使用忘的一干二净,重新百度搜索,自己尝试后实现需求。我的业务需求是父页面中嵌套了一个子页面,父页面的一个卡片列表区域通过点击卡片项跳到子页面,原先子页面有返回按钮,现在取消子页面的返回按钮,在父页面通过点击菜单项实现返回。子页面需要填报数据,如果有正在编辑的内容未保存,点菜
二、axios使用 cnpm 安装 axios。cnpm install axios -S安装其他插件的时候,可以直接在 main.js 中引入并 Vue.use(),但是 axios 并不能 use,只能每个需要发送请求的组件中即时引入。为了解决这个问题,有两种开发思路,一是在引入 axios 之后,修改原型链,二是结合 Vuex,封装一个 aciton。2.1 改进方案一:改写原型链首先在ma
转载 1月前
58阅读
Axios一. Axios介绍二. Axios特点三. Axios安装1. NPM2. CDN四. Axios简单测试1. Get请求测试2. Post请求测试3. 执行多个并发请求4.Axios的Restful风格的API5. Axios的高级使用配置对象6. Axios的实例创建+配置五. Axios模块封装六. Axios拦截器 一. Axios介绍Axios 是一个基于 promise
转载 2023-07-04 02:45:07
122阅读
一、为什么要封装axios    api统一管理,不管接口有多少,所有的接口都可以非常清晰,容易维护。    通常我们的项目会越做越大,页面也会越来越多,如果页面非常的少,直接用axios也没有什么大的影响,那页面组件多了起来,上百个接口呢,这个时候后端改了接口,多加了一个参数什么的呢?那就只有找到那个页面,进去修改,整个过程很繁琐,不易于项目的维护和迭代。
自定义事件通过prop属性,父组件可以向子组件传递数据,而子组件的自定义事件就是用来将内部的数据报告给父组件的。<div id="app3"> <my-component2 v-on:myclick="onClick"></my-component2> </div> <script> Vue.component('my-com
vue-cli里面使用axios全局引用vue2.01.全局安装axiosnpm install axios2.首先在 main.js 中引入 axiosimport axios from 'axios'3.将 axios 改写为 Vue 的原型属性Vue.prototype.$http= axios4.配置config5.发送请求如果请求失败可以尝试重启前端项目局部引用vue2.01.全局安装
转载 2023-08-21 16:49:57
246阅读
vue axios跨域请求后台数据问题来了配置代理测试请求问题又来了切换后台项目 最近刚开始学习web网页开发,同事说公司开发使用在vue框架就学习一下编写个小demo。本次采用前后端分离项目,后端是springmvc。问题来了后端项目接口经过postman测试通过,在后端框架中测试也是通过,但是在vue项目中请求就是没有相应。当不同服务器、不同端口访问数据时涉及到跨域支援跨域问题。 在未配置跨
转载 2023-09-02 13:51:31
112阅读
使用axios时,配置选项中包含params和data两项,它们是有区别的:1、params是添加到url的请求字符串中的,用于get请求。 (get请求中没有data传值方式)2、data是添加到请求体(Request Body)中的, 一般用于post请求。(post请求也可以使用params方式传值,除Request Method为POST外,其他同get)axios get请求params
# 解决VueAxios发送不了请求的问题 最近在使用Vue框架进行开发时,发现了一个常见问题:无法通过Axios发送请求。Axios是一个基于Promise的HTTP客户端,用于与服务器进行数据交互。如果出现无法发送请求的情况,可能是由于一些常见的问题导致的。本文将介绍一些可能的原因,并给出解决方法。 ## 问题描述 在使用Vue中的Axios发送请求时,可能会遇到以下问题: - 请求无
原创 1月前
36阅读
基础介绍开始一般post不允许发送复杂数据类型,比如object和array,而jquery的ajax封装了这个方法,使得可以发送复杂数据格式,代码$.ajax({ type: 'POST', url: 'http://www.skybseo.cn/php/jiekou.php', data: {
  • 1
  • 2
  • 3
  • 4
  • 5